Walk the Peak in Festival Week – 25th April to 4th May
 
The Peak District celebrates five years of the Walking Festival in 2009... and with more than 100 walks and activities over the duration of the 10-day festival, there'll be something for all ages and abilities!
 
Set amid an extraordinary range of landscapes, from the dramatic heather moorlands and gritstone edges of the Dark Peak to the gently rolling limestone valleys of the White Peak, the Peak District Walking Festival will include a wide range of guided walks with local experts leading walks on themes such as food and drink, ghosts, heritage and geology.
